Output d617bf660839ed3dbcd20888dc7bb9797bec7dfa2286e6c5417c64a164136957:37

value
77910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e07c4a691821cb81f02fd83465e1e557317777f3 OP_EQUAL
address
3N9zBP2kHXeLShFCG3EwLsecxVKir62jNf
transaction
d617bf660839ed3dbcd20888dc7bb9797bec7dfa2286e6c5417c64a164136957
spent
true